Latin

Etymology

ostendō +‎ -īvus.

Pronunciation

Adjective

ostēnsīvus (feminine ostēnsīva, neuter ostēnsīvum); first/second-declension adjective

  1. (Late Latin) ostensive

Declension

First/second-declension adjective.

Descendants

  • English: ostensive
  • French: ostensif
  • Italian: ostensivo
